job description - Protocol Officer


  • Our Client seeks the services of a Protocol Officer, the PO would be responsible for the planning and execution of protocol activities and events for the company, its Board of Directors, and other VIP guests.
  • The Protocol Officer will work closely with the CEO, C-suite executives, and the Board of Directors to ensure that all protocol activities are carried out in a smooth, efficient, and professional manner.
  • He or she will be responsible for developing and maintaining relationships with key stakeholders, both internally and externally.
  • The Protocol Officer must be able to think quickly on his or her feet and be able to handle last-minute changes with grace and poise.

Job Description

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for all protocol-related inquiries, including but not limited to questions on precedence, dress, gifts, and invitations
  • Develop and maintain strong working relationships with key internal and external stakeholders to ensure the successful execution of protocol activities
  • Plan and coordinate high-level events hosted by the organization, including but not limited to state visits, summits, conferences, and gala dinners
  • Oversee the development and implementation of event-specific protocols, in close coordination with relevant teams
  • Liaise with security personnel to develop and implement security plans for protocol-related events
  • Manage VIP travel arrangements and accommodation bookings in accordance with organizational policy and budget
  • Prepare detailed itineraries for visiting dignitaries, ensuring that all logistical needs are taken care of in a timely and efficient manner
  • Serve as on-site coordinator for protocol-related events, managing last-minute changes and unforeseen challenges as they arise
  • Write post-event reports documenting successes, lessons learned, and areas for improvement
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of international diplomatic protocol standards and best practices
  • Stay abreast of current affairs and developments relevant to the organization’s work
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in International Relations, Political Science, or a related field
  • 3 - 5 years of professional experience in the protocol or a related area
  • Professional certification in the protocol (e.g., Certified Protocol Officer from the Association of Protocol Officers International)
  • Experience living or working abroad
  • In-depth knowledge of protocol procedures and etiquette
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English; proficiency in a second language preferred
  • Strong research, analytical, and organizational skills
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team
  • Flexibility and adaptability to changing situations.
